Sunflower- Crusted Trout
Create a fish-dish that is crunchy and crisp on the outside, tender and flavorful on the inside. Serves 4 to 8 8 fresh trout fillets ¼ cup salted sunflower seeds ¼ cup all-purpose flour ½ teaspoon fresh-ground black pepper ½ cup sunflower oil or canola oil
Rinse the fish fillets and pat them dry. In the bowl of a food processor, chop the sunflower seeds to a fine meal. Scrape the sunflower seed meal onto a plate and combine with the cornmeal, flour, and pepper. Dredge both sides of each fillet with the flour mixture.
Heat the oil in a cast-iron skillet over medium-high heat. Add the fillets and pan-fry them, turning them once, for about 3 minutes on each side, until they are browned and crisp but not overcooked. Serve hot.
